How do you make a mirages?​

Answers

Answer: when the ground is very hot and the air is cool. The hot ground warms a layer of air just above the ground. When the light moves through the cold air and into the layer of hot air it is refracted (bent). A layer of very warm air near the ground refracts the light from the sky nearly into a U-shaped bend.

An ideal spring is mounted horizontally, with its left end fixed. The force constant of the spring is 170 N/m. A glider of mass 1.2 kg is attached to the free end of the spring. The glider is pulled toward the right along a frictionless air track, and then released. Now the glider is moving in simple harmonic motion with amplitude 0.045 m. The motion is horizontal (one-dimensional). Suddenly, Slimer* holding an apple flies in and approaches the glider. Slimer drops the apple vertically onto the glider from a very small height. The apple sticks to the glider. The mass of the apple is 0.48 kg.

Required:
Calculate the new amplitude of the motion of the glider with apple if the apple is dropped at the moment when the glider passes through its equilibrium position, x = 0 m.

Answers

Answer:

Explanation:

First of all we shall find the velocity at equilibrium point of mass 1.2 kg .

It will be ω A , where ω is angular frequency and A is amplitude .

ω = √ ( k / m )

= √ (170 / 1.2 )

= 11.90 rad /s

amplitude A = .045 m

velocity at middle point ( maximum velocity ) = 11.9 x .045 m /s

= .5355 m /s

At middle point , no force acts so we can apply law of conservation of momentum

m₁ v₁ = ( m₁ + m₂ ) v

1.2 x .5355 = ( 1.2 + .48 ) x v

v = .3825 m /s

= 38.25 cm /s

Let new amplitude be A₁ .

1/2 m v² = 1/2 k A₁²

( 1.2 + .48 ) x v² = 170 x A₁²

( 1.2 + .48 ) x .3825² = 170 x A₁²

A₁ = .0379 m

New amplitude is .0379 m

What type of boundary creates earthquakes? What type of boundaries create volcanoes? Compare and contrast these two types of plate movements, and explain how these geologic events occur.

Answers

Answer:

The three types of plate boundaries are Convergent, Divergent and Transform.

The convergent plate boundary is when two plates move towards each other. In this case it has three possibilities:

An oceanic-continental convergent: In this case the the oceanic plate goes beneath the continental in a subduction zone. And due to this process, the continental crust crumples and forms mountains.

An oceanic-oceanic convergent: Here the denser plate goes beneath the other in a subduction zone.

A continental-continental convergent: And in this case the thickness of the crust doubles as the convergent makes mountains.

The divergent plate boundary is when two plates move away from each other. This type of plate boundaries happens between the same plate type, this way it has two possibilities:

An oceanic-oceanic divergent: In this case when two plates goes apart, the magma from the mantle goes up to fill the gap that the separation made.

A continental-continental divergent: And here it’s characterized by rift valleys.

The third and last type is the transform plate boundary. And this one happens when two plates slide along each other horizontally.

The take-up reel of a cassette tape has a radius of 2.5 cm. Find the length of the tape that passes around the reel in 7.1 s when the reel rotates at an average angular speed of 1.9 rad/s.

Answers

Answer:

s = 0.337 m

Explanation:

First, we will find the angular displacement of the reel:

[tex]\theta = \omega t[/tex]

where,

θ = angular displacement = ?

ω = angular speed = 1.9 rad/s

t = time taken = 7.1 s

Therefore,

θ = (1.9\ rad/s)(7.1 s)

θ = 13.5 rad

Now, we will find out the length of tape:

s = rθ

where,

s = length of tape = ?

r = radius of reel = 2.5 cm = 0.025 m

Therefore,

s = (0.025 m)(13.5 rad)

s = 0.337 m

1. A 2,000-turn solenoid is 65 cm long and has cross-sectional area 30 cm2. What rate of change of current will produce a 600 Volts emf in this solenoid.

Answers

Answer:

[tex]\frac{dI}{dt} = 2.59\ x\ 10^4\ A/s[/tex]

Explanation:

First, we will calculate the inductance of the solenoid by using the following formula:

[tex]L = \frac{\mu_o AN^2}{l}[/tex]

where,

L = self-inductance of solenoid = ?

μ₀ = permeability of free space = 4π x 10⁻⁷ N/A²

A = Cross-sectional area = 30 cm² = 3 x 10⁻³ m²

N  = No. of turns = 2000

l = length = 65 cm = 0.65 m

Therefore,

[tex]L = \frac{(4\pi\ x\ 10^{-7}\ N/A^2)(3\ x\ 10^{-3}\ m^2)(2000)^2}{0.65\ m}\\\\L = 0.0232\ H[/tex]

Now, we will use Faraday's law to calculate the rate of change of current:

[tex]emf = L\frac{dI}{dt}\\\\ \frac{dI}{dt} =\frac{emf}{L} \\\\ \frac{dI}{dt} =\frac{600\ V}{0.0232\ H}\\\\ \frac{dI}{dt} = 2.59\ x\ 10^4\ A/s[/tex]

g You shine orange laser light that has a wavelength of 600 nm through a narrow slit. The slit forms a diffraction pattern on a distant screen that has been set up behind the slit. The first dark fringe in the diffraction pattern is 4.0 cm from the center point of the pattern. If you replace the orange laser with an unknown laser and observe that the second dark fringe of the diffraction pattern appear at 4.0 cm from the center point, what is the wavelength of the unknown laser

Answers

Answer:

 λ = 3 10⁻⁷ m,   UV laser

Explanation:

The diffraction phenomenon is described by the expression

         a sin θ = m λ

let's use trigonometry

         tan θ = y / L

as in this phenomenon the angles are small

        tan θ = [tex]\frac{sin \ \theta}{cos \ \theta}[/tex] = sin θ

        sin θ = y / L

we substitute

      a y / L = m  λ

let's apply this equation to the initial data

       a  0.04 / L = 1 600 10⁻⁹

       a / L = 1.5 10⁻⁵

now they tell us that we change the laser and we have y = 0.04 m for m = 2

      a 0.04 / L = 2  λ

       a / L = 50  λ

we solve the two expression is

         1.5 10⁻⁵ = 50  λ

          λ = 1.5 10⁻⁵ / 50

          λ = 3 10⁻⁷ m

    UV laser
